MX25L12833FM2I in Macronix MX25 / GigaDevice GD25 SPI Flash Family

The MX25L12833F is a member of the Macronix MXSMIO (Serial Multi-I/O) family, offering 128Mbit of high-performance NOR Flash memory. This sub-family utilizes a standard SPI interface supporting Single, Dual, and Quad I/O modes, as well as QPI functionality for enhanced throughput. Manufactured by Macronix, these ICs are engineered for high-reliability systems requiring fast execute-in-place (XiP) performance, primarily serving as non-volatile storage for boot code, firmware, and application data in industrial and consumer electronics.

Variants in This Sub-Family

Variants within the MX25L12833F series primarily differ in their physical packaging and temperature grading. Common packages include 8-SOP (200mil), 8-WSON (6x5mm), and 16-SOP (300mil), allowing for varied PCB footprints. Additionally, parts are sorted into Industrial (-40C to +85C) and Industrial Plus grades to meet specific environmental requirements. Speed ratings and voltage ranges remain consistent across these physical variants.
